Train Travel Tips- Mumbai to Goa and other places

If you are coming to Goa from Mumbai, there is no network of trains involved. However if you are coming from elsewhere in India a lot of train network is involved and you need to make sure your train booking and reservation is perfect.
1) Check and make sure the details on your ticket are correct.
2) You need to understand that CNF stands for confirmed ticket, RAC is Reserved Against Cancellation and WL is Wait List. If your ticket is of WL status you do not have a right to enter the compartment. With RAC status atleast you will have a seat.
3) Carry some sort of personal identification document.
4) Avoid second class travel.
5) Carry a lock and a chain normally available at the railway stations to secure your baggage to the seat.
6) Never pay any agents no matter what promises they make. Indian railways has come out with a service called as 'Tatkal' to avoid any middleman, agents or touts.
7) Under the Tatkal service you can purchase tickets at the normal ticket counters by paying an extra charge. This service starts 5 days before the journey date. This service is useful incase you need to purchase tickets at a short notice or unplanned visits.

10) Train Coaches are designated as follows;
H1, H2 etc- first AC
A1, A2 etc - 2 tier AC
B1, B2 etc - 3 tier AC
S1, S2 etc - Sleeper Class

Mumbai to Goa by Konkan Railway

After having viewed some beautiful beaches in South Goa and before we move to other beaches we will now tell you how you can come to Goa from Mumbai formerly Bombay by train.
Konkan Railway is in service for the last 10 years. The Konkan Railway project is a masterpiece. It has reduced train journey travel duration by over 50%.
The Konkan Railway journey from Mumbai to Goa is very exciting and comfortable. As the name suggests the train travels through the lush green Konkan region. This region is famous for its delicious Ratnagiri Alfonso Mangoes.
The Konkan Railway website Konkanrailway.com provides a lot of information which includes the train timetable, fares, online booking, seat availability. Besides this passenger information, the Konkan Raiway website provides other information such as the total number of stations, the station names, the current position of the train, the number of tunnels, the tunnel lengths, the number of bridges, the longest bridge, the number of viaducts, the tallest viaduct and more.
The journey from Mumbai to Goa is around 11 hours and there is a pantry in the train, lunch and dinner is not a problem.
We are providing below for ready reference the train names, departure and arrival times;
All times are in IST.
1) Train Number 0103 Mandovi Express departsfrom Mumabi CST (Chatrapati Shivaji Terminus) at 6.55 am and arrives Goa Margao station at 6.45 pm.
2) Train Number 0104 Mandovi Express departs from Goa Margao station at 9.40 am and arrives Mumbai CST at 11.45 pm
3) Train Number 0111 Konkan Kanya departs from Mumbai CST at 11.05 pm and arrives Goa Margao station at 10.45 am.
4) Train Number 011 Konkan Kanya departs from Goa Margao station at 6.00 pm and arrives Mumbai CST at 5.50 am.
5) Train Number 6345 Netravati Express departs from Mumbai LTT (Lokmanya Tilak Terminus) at 11.40 am and arrives Goa Margao station at 12.40 pm
6) Train Number 6346 Netravati Express departs from Goa Margao station at 5.45 am and arrives Mumbai LTT at 4.40 pm.
7) Train Number 2051 Jan Shatabdi departs from Mumbai CST at 5.10 am and arrives Goa Margao station at 2.10 pm.
8) Train Number 2052 Jan Shatabdi departs from Goa Margao station at 2.30 pm and arrives Mumbai CST at 11.20 pm
9) Train Number 2619 Matsyagandha departs from Mumbai LTT at 2.05 pm and arrives Goa Margao station at 12.10 am.
10) Train Number 2620 Matsyagandha departs from Goa Margao station at 8.45 pm and arrives Mumbai LTT at 6.35 am.

How to go to Palolem Beach

Palolem Beach is in south Goa. One has to go to Canacona to reach their. Canacona is one of Goa's taluka. To be able to go to Canacona you have to come to the Kadamba bus stand at Fatorda which is very close to Margao city. Some buses go directly to Palolem via Canacona from the Fatorda bus stand but the frequency is not good. Hence it is better to take the bus going to Canacona and alight at the last stop which is called the Canacona bus stand this is also called as Chaudi. The journey is roughly 1 hr and 20 min covering a distance of around 45 km. The fare is Rs.19. From the bus stand at Canacona you can get buses going directly to Palolem beach which is around 20 min away and the fare is Rs.7, the frequency is not good. In case you are impatient to wait for the direct bus, you can take the bus going to Agonda if available. You will need to tell the bus driver that you are going to Palolem Beach and he will drop you at the Agonda-Palolem junction. From the junction it is 2 km distance and you can walk it out. The fare would be in the range of Rs.5.
Alternatively you can hire an autorickshaw from the Canacona bus stand. The fare is Rs.50 not per person but per ride. It is recommended to fix the rate before you hire the autorickshaw. If you have decided to hit the beach straight from the airport you could do that as well that will be around 60 km journey. At the Dabolim airport you can hire a prepaid taxi, the taxi counter is run by the government and is outside the airport. In this way you will be satisfied that you have been charged the correct fare and not more. So why wait, get to the Palolem Beach and have a great time.
